FirstBank supports SOS with GHȼ50,000 donation
[B&FT Online - Ghana] - 3/06/2025
FirstBank Ghana has donated GHȼ50,000 to SOS Ghana, a non-profit organization dedicated to supporting vulnerable children and families, as part of the Bank’s commitment to supporting children and communities in Ghana. The donation was received by Eugenia Serwaah Cobbina, the Fund Development (…)
